... Compressive buckling of hollow cylinders due to internal pressure is a little-known phenomenon that can affect pressure testing of plastic pipe. High strength pipe materials with large dimension ratios particularly exhibit the phenomenon, but it can also occur in pipe with low dimension ratios...

... Local buckling of a delaminated group of plies can lead to high interlaminar stresses and delamination growth. The mechanics of instability-related delamination growth (IRDG) had been described previously for the through-width delamination. This paper uses the results of finite-element analyses...
